Robin Bennett.

Stood for Green Party of England and Wales in Henley at the 2017 General Election. Not elected — so there is no parliamentary record to show, but here is the contest in full and where the seat stands now.

Finished 4th of 6 with 1,864 votes (3.3%).

The result in full · 2017 General Election

CandidatePartyVotesShare
John Howell✓ electedCon33,74959.1%
Oliver KavanaghLab11,45520.1%
Laura CoyleLD8,48514.9%
Robin BennettGreen1,8643.3%
Tim Scott1,1542.0%
Patrick Gray3920.7%

Majority 22,294 · 57,099 votes cast.
